Sharp increase in profit and stronger margins in the third quarter
Quarter July-
- Net sales amounted to MSEK 428.4 (426.8)
- The gross margin was 39.2% (36.8)
- EBITA improved 19.4% to MSEK 34.4 (28.8)
- The EBITA margin was 8.0% (6.7)
- Net profit amounted to MSEK 15.9 (8.9)

Significant events in the third quarter
- The pandemic restrictions, and their impact on our operations, were lifted on 29 September
- Customers returned to in-person visits, leading to positive sales growth of 2.8% in stores
Akademibokhandeln entered a three-year partnership as a primary partner with the non-profit group Berättarministeriet
Comments from the CEO
During the quarter, gross margins increased 7% and EBITA increased 19% compared with the same quarter last year. Physical stores posted sales growth of 3%, Akademibokhandeln Online's sales increased by 20% and sales of other products increased by 7%.
During the third quarter, we continued our long-term focus on measures to enhance profitability, which resulted in a 7% improvement in gross margins and significantly improved EBITA of MSEK 34.4 (28.8). The EBITA margin LTM is thus 5% and steadily increased during the year. I'm very pleased with our price optimisation efforts, and the investments made in expanding the range of other products have had a clear effect on our profitability.
It is positive that our total sales during the quarter were stable, reaching MSEK 428.4 (426.8) despite a strong comparative quarter in 2020 when online channels increased significantly, and we saw a recovery in stores. Compared with the more typical year of 2019, third-quarter sales increased by 3%.
The third quarter was positive for the Akademibokhandeln brand. We saw a continued stream of customers returning to stores and a 3% increase in sales.
Akademibokhandeln Online also posted a strong sales increase of 20%. Sales for Bokus Online decreased by 4% during the quarter, which was better than the market, while profitability surged by 38%. Compared with the more typical year of 2019, sales increased by 12%. So far this year, our two online channels have experienced strong sales growth of 15% over the previous year.
During the quarter, we continued to invest in our digital transformation to generate growth. For example, we will soon be launching new solutions to improve the in-store customer experience.
